Tải bản đầy đủ (.doc) (2 trang)

xếp loai học lực HS bằng pascal

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(24.49 KB, 2 trang )

program tinhtb;
var toan,ly,hoa,van,su,dia,anh,sinh,CN,nhac,MT,TD,GDCD:real;
DTBCM:real;
begin
writeln(' nhap vao mon toan');readln(toan);
writeln(' nhap vao mon ly');readln(ly);
writeln(' nhap vao mon hoa');readln(hoa);
writeln(' nhap vao mon van');readln(van);
writeln(' nhap vao mon su');readln(su);
writeln(' nhap vao mon dia');readln(dia);
writeln(' nhap vao mon anh');readln(anh);
writeln(' nhap vao mon sinh');readln(sinh);
writeln(' nhap vao mon CN');readln(CN);
writeln(' nhap vao mon nhac');readln(nhac);
writeln(' nhap vao mon MT');readln(MT);
writeln(' nhap vao mon TD');readln(TD);
writeln(' nhap vao mon GDCD');readln(GDCD);
DTBCM:=
(toan*2+ly+hoa+van*2+su+dia+anh+sinh+CN+nhac+MT+GDCD+TD)/15;
if( DTBCM>=8) and (toan>=8)and(ly>=6.5)and(hoa>=6.5)and(su>=6.5)
and(dia>=6.5) and(anh>=6.5)
and(sinh>=6.5)and(CN>=6.5)and(nhac>=6.5)
and(MT>=6.5) and(TD>=6.5) and(GDCD>=6.5) and(Van>=6.5)
then
begin
write('Xep loai HLgioi');readln;
end
else
if( DTBCM>=8) and (van>=8)and(ly>=6.5)and(hoa>=6.5)and(su>=6.5)
and(dia>=6.5) and(anh>=6.5)
and(sinh>=6.5)and(CN>=6.5)and(nhac>=6.5)


and(MT>=6.5) and(TD>=6.5) and(GDCD>=6.5) and(Toan>=6.5) then
begin
write('Xep loai HLgioi');readln;
end else
if( DTBCM>=6.5) and (van>=6.5)and(ly>=5)and(hoa>=5)and(su>=5)
and(dia>=5) and(anh>=5) and(sinh>=5)and(CN>=5)and(nhac>=5)
and(MT>=5) and(TD>=5) and(GDCD>=5) and(Toan>=5) then
begin
write('Xep loai HLkha');readln;end
else
if( DTBCM>=6.5) and (van>=5)and(ly>=5)and(hoa>=5)and(su>=5)
and(dia>=5) and(anh>=5) and(sinh>=5)and(CN>=5)and(nhac>=5)
and(MT>=5) and(TD>=5) and(GDCD>=5) and(Toan>=6.5) then
begin
write('Xep loai HLkha');readln;end else
if( DTBCM>=6.5) and (van>=5)and(ly>=5)and(hoa>=5)and(su>=5)
and(dia>=5) and(anh>=5) and(sinh>=5)and(CN>=5)and(nhac>=5)
and(MT>=5) and(TD>=5) and(GDCD>=5) and(Toan>=6.5) then
begin
write('Xep loai HLkha');readln;end
else
if( DTBCM>=5) and (van>=5)and(ly>=3.5)and(hoa>=3.5)and(su>=3.5)
and(dia>=3.5) and(anh>=3.5)
and(sinh>=3.5)and(CN>=3.5)and(nhac>=3.5)
and(MT>=3.5) and(TD>=3.5) and(GDCD>=3.5) and(Toan>=3.5) then
begin
write('Xep loai HLtb');readln;end
else
if( DTBCM>=5) and (van>=3.5)and(ly>=3.5)and(hoa>=3.5)and(su>=3.5)
and(dia>=3.5) and(anh>=3.5)

and(sinh>=3.5)and(CN>=3.5)and(nhac>=3.5)
and(MT>=3.5) and(TD>=3.5) and(GDCD>=3.5) and(Toan>=5) then
begin
write('Xep loai HLtb');readln;end
{if( DTBCM<5) then}
else
begin
writeln('Xep loai HLYeu');readln;end;
end.
end.

×